Job Description
As a Data Engineering Lead at Annalect, you will play a crucial role in building data pipelines and developing data set processes. Your primary responsibility will be to lead teams working on software and data products within the Annalect Engineering Team. You will be involved in technical architecture, design, and development of software products, as well as researching and evaluating new technical solutions. Your expertise will contribute to driving the vision forward for data engineering projects by improving standards and building high-performing, collaborative teams. Key Responsibilities: - Develop and implement customized Google Cloud solutions to meet clients" specific needs. - Design, deploy, and manage scalable Google Cloud architectures using services such as BigQuery, Firestore, DataForm, Cloud Composer, Data Flow, and Cloud Run. - Utilize Python, Git, Terraform, and Docker to optimize client applications, services, and infrastructures. - Implement DevOps methodologies for efficient software development, deployment, and monitoring. - Collaborate with Google Cloud Consultants to align technical solutions with business objectives. - Keep abreast of the latest advancements in Google Cloud technologies and best practices. Soft Skills: - Technical Communication: Clearly articulate complex techn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ders. - Team Collaboration: Work effectively with diverse teams and understand the contributions of specialists. - Adaptability: Quickly respond to new client needs and changes in technical requirements. - Problem-solving: Approach challenges innovatively and provide effective solutions. - Continuous Learning: Stay updated on the latest Google Cloud developments and industry trends. Additional Skills: - Proficiency in at least one object-oriented programming language, particularly Python. - Familiarity with SQL and NoSQL databases. - Knowledge of CI/CD tools and their integration with cloud platforms. - Optional: Understanding of Kubernetes and container orchestration. - Optional: Experience with Infrastructure as Code (IaC) tools, especially Terraform. Qualifications: - Degree in Computer Science or Engineering or equivalent professional experience. - Understanding and experience with Agile methodologies and their application in team settings. - Experience in working with global teams and managing offshore resources.,
